PPS rules have always been, pay on all signups, even if the person refunds or charges back - excluding a fraud account, and excluding it being in the terms. It has been this way long before your program was around.
Most real world sales call it "commissions" not Pay Per Signup... commissions almost always include a salary, which includes lots of rules.
PPS means exactly what it says - paid on every signup. What happens after the signup, is not the affiliates issue.
When I see programs deduct on PPS, I see amateurs running a business structure they don't fully understand.
